Abstract

The utility model is related to a kind of Multifunctional petri dishs applied in cell scientific research, its ontology being made of this body sidewall of circular body bottom portion and tubular, the bottom of described body sidewall is fixedly connected with the outer edge of the body bottom portion, and the outer edge of the body bottom portion lower face is equipped with the cricoid extension side extended downwardly;Ontology sidewall upper face is equipped with cricoid annular groove, and when multiple culture dish overlappings, the extension side of a culture dish is positioned in the annular groove at the top of another culture dish;The intrinsic central vertical is equipped with the newel being connect with the body bottom portion, dismantled and assembled between the newel and the ontology madial wall to be equipped with demarcation strip.The selectable placement demarcation strip of the culture dish and ontology is divided into several parts, and it can carry out itself stacking so that very easy to use.

Background technology
In biotechnology research field, culture medium is that laboratory is extremely universal and common nutrient matrix, contains culture The container of base can be described as culture dish.
However, in the prior art, culture dish is short cylinder, when individually placing, since bottom surface greatly can be very Smoothly placed.But it needs culture dish being stacked together in test, in order to save space, when most, and It can not itself be stacked with regard to culture dish at present, if closeing the lid, although can stack reluctantly, since smooth in appearance makes it It is easy to slide or fall down, therefore user can seldom carry out stacking for culture dish itself.Therefore, special stacking frame can only be used Son is stacked, then resulting in, use is cumbersome, and picks and places also cumbersome, and cost also accordingly increases.In addition, current Culture dish structure is fairly simple, and inside causes it to use very inconvenient, such as traditional structure is simple without any other structure Culture dish in practical applications so that the counting of bacterium colony is cumbersome, and cannot achieve connecing for a variety of strain of culture medium Kind, comparison etc..Therefore, culture dish is improved extremely important.

Embodiment 1
As shown in Fig. 1~2, a kind of Multifunctional petri dish applied in cell scientific research, by circular body bottom portion 11 The ontology 1 constituted with this body sidewall 10 of tubular, the bottom of described body sidewall 10 and the outer edge of the body bottom portion 11 are solid Fixed connection;The outer edge of the body bottom portion lower face is equipped with the cricoid extension side 6 extended downwardly, and the bottom on extension side 6 End face is plane, and bottom face is all in the same horizontal plane everywhere so that culture dish can be placed smoothly.
The upper surface of described body sidewall is equipped with cricoid annular groove 19, and the width of the annular groove 19 is not less than described The thickness on extension side 6, and the diameter of the annular groove is consistent with the diameter on extension side, when multiple culture dishes overlap When, the extension side of a culture dish is positioned in the annular groove at the top of another culture dish, as shown in figure 4, being three ontologies The schematic diagram that (1a, 1b, 1c) is stacked.
The bottom of the annular groove is equipped with the first flat thin magnet;The bottom on the extension side is equipped with can be with first magnet Magnetic the second attracting flat thin magnet of piece is so that the overlapping of two neighboring culture dish is more reliable, then also not when stacking multiple culture dishes It is easy to fall down.
As shown in Fig. 5~7, the central vertical in the ontology 1 is equipped with the newel 2 being connect with 1 bottom of the ontology, It is dismantled and assembled between 1 madial wall of the newel 2 and the ontology to be equipped with demarcation strip 5.
Multiple grooves 21 that can accommodate the separation plate thickness, the groove 21 are uniformly provided on the newel 2 Perpendicular to the newel 2, and the open top of the groove 21 is located on the top end face of the newel 2.
It is equipped with multiple grooves 4 that can accommodate 5 thickness of the demarcation strip vertically on the madial wall of the ontology 1, it is described Demarcation strip 5 is dismantled and assembled be set between the groove 21 and the groove 4 so that the glassware it is selectable be divided into it is more A region.
Dismantled and assembled be equipped with can be linked in bolumn cap 3 on the newel on the newel 2, then without demarcation strip when It waits, is fastened on newel with bolumn cap 3.
Elastic layer 22 is equipped in the groove vertically, as shown in figure 3, the height of the height of the elastic layer and the groove Unanimously so that the demarcation strip can be connected on the elastic layer, then when placing demarcation strip 5, first ditch will can be positioned over one end In slot, some power is then made to compress elastic layer 22 on demarcation strip, then the other end of demarcation strip can be easily positioned over very much In groove, then power is removed, demarcation strip is just very firm to be placed in ontology.
The groove 4 is uniformly arranged on the madial wall of the ontology, and setting quantity can be decided according to the actual requirements.
As further preferred embodiment, as shown in figs. 34, the extension side 6 is by multiple completely the same arcs Piece 61 is constituted, and multiple arc-like sheets 61 constitute cricoid and extension that is being positioned in annular groove 19 side 6.
As further preferred embodiment, the bottom of the annular groove is provided with cricoid first flat thin magnet.
As further preferred embodiment, second flat thin magnet is at least set on two arc-like sheets.It is preferred that setting The quantity for being equipped with the arc-like sheet of second flat thin magnet is even number, and is central symmetry two-by-two, that is, be symmetrical arranged so that It is more reliable when culture dish is stacked together.
As further preferred embodiment, the depth of the annular groove is not less than the height on the extension side, then exists When stacking, extension side is submerged in annular groove completely, then the bottom of the ontology of extension side both sides just with the side wall of annular groove both sides Upper surface combines, then so that stacking more firm.
As further preferred embodiment, the height on the extension side is 2~10mm, preferably 4~7mm;It is preferred that The depth of annular groove is bigger 1~2mm than height by the extension.
As further preferred embodiment, the top end opening of the groove 4 is located at the top end face of the wall of the ontology, The bottom end of the groove is located at 2~5mm above the bottom surface of ontology;Then culture medium etc. can pass through from below, then can ensure The culture medium liquid level of demarcation strip both sides flushes.
As further preferred embodiment, the bottom end of the groove is located at 2~5mm above the bottom surface of the ontology Place.
As further preferred embodiment, the bottom of the groove and the bottom of the groove are located at same level On.
As further preferred embodiment, the ontology 1 is equipped with the body cap being fastened on the ontology 1.
As further preferred embodiment, the height of the newel 2 is not higher than the depth of the ontology, facilitates this The storage of body or with the cooperation of body cap etc..
